Why AI Health Detection Requires a Verification Process

AI health detection is not a standardized feature category. Some suppliers treat it as an algorithm that selects massage programs; others implement it as a hardware-driven body-shape analysis that adjusts roller position, intensity and speed. Because no safety certification currently evaluates the performance of an AI health-detection algorithm, buyers at the research and evaluation stage must rely on a combination of product documentation, certification records and specification sheets.

A practical verification checklist for this stage includes:

  • Market-entry certifications: ETL for the US and Canada, CE for the EU, FDA listing for the US market, ISO 13485 and ISO 9001 for quality-system credibility.
  • Mechanism classification: 4D, 3D or dual-mechanism, and the type of track, including SL-track length and curvature.
  • Detection hardware: automatic body-shape detection and how the chair uses this data.
  • Feature availability by model, since a multi-model 4D series may spread across economic, mid-range and high-end configurations with different feature sets.
  • Electrical compatibility: power input, rated power and plug configuration for the destination region.
  • Supply-chain and customization capabilities: OEM/ODM options, lead time, quality-control procedures and warranty terms.

How the AI Health Detection Feature Works with the 4D Mechanism

ZHOUQI's 4D series combines several technical layers, and AI health detection should be understood as one layer within a larger intelligent massage system.

4D Max manipulator. The 4D mechanism adds dynamic speed and rhythm control to three-dimensional roller movement. Industry definitions describe advanced 4D rollers as simulating human pacing by varying speed and rhythm across three dimensions plus a fourth dimension of speed control. In the product specification, this is described as creating "a combination of rigidity and softness, comfort and safety."

Automatic body-shape detection. The chair automatically detects the user's body shape to locate key massage points, with the stated benefit of helping the chair "exactly touch the sore point, better understand your needs." This is the input layer that enables personalization.

AI health detection. The manufacturer documents that AI health detection is available on the 4D massage chair. In practical terms, this feature draws on the chair's detection and program-selection logic to support more individualized massage sessions. Buyers should treat this as a product-feature declaration rather than a medical claim; the certification scope is discussed in the FAQ section below.

SL track and zero-gravity positioning. The series uses a 130 cm SL track designed to follow the curve of the spine. Zero-gravity recline is activated with a one-button design; industry research indicates that zero-gravity positioning distributes body weight evenly, helping to reduce spinal pressure and enhance massage depth.

Additional supporting features include a three-row foot roller with calf massage, automatic leg-angle adjustment, auto footrest extension, full-body airbag massage for the shoulders, hips, hands, legs and feet, heating massage on the foot and waist, a 7-inch touch remote controller with quick buttons, Bluetooth and voice control, wireless charging, 24 auto programs, and a "Favorite" function for saving preferred programs.

4D with AI Health Detection vs. Traditional Massage Chair Options

Comparing a 4D AI-enabled chair with conventional 3D or fixed-program chairs helps buyers decide whether the additional cost is justified. A 3D massage chair moves the roller mechanism along a track with control over three axes: up and down, left and right, and forward and backward pressure. A 4D chair adds a fourth dimension of variable speed and rhythm, allowing the massage to imitate a therapist's pacing more closely. AI health detection operates on top of the mechanism: it uses body-shape input and program-selection logic to adapt the massage to the individual user rather than applying a fixed sequence.

Two practical observations follow from this comparison. First, the mechanism upgrade affects more than the massage feel: rated power rises from 150W on the 3D series to 200W on the 4D series, and the physical envelope changes, with the 4D chair using a more compact box dimension of 1460×810×1200mm versus 1950×810×880mm on the 3D series. Logistics planners need these figures early because they affect freight cost, warehouse space and final-mile delivery. Second, the feature set differs: AI health detection is documented for the 4D series, while the 3D series specification does not include it.

Limitations and boundaries. A credible evaluation should also acknowledge what AI health detection does not deliver:
  • It is not a medical diagnostic function. The FDA certification applicable to the 4D massage chair follows 21 CFR 807.39, a market-entry registration and listing requirement, not a clinical validation of the AI feature.
  • Safety standards such as UL 1647:2015 and CSA C22.2#68:2018 govern electrical and mechanical safety; they do not measure the performance of AI health-detection logic.
  • The real-world performance of AI health detection depends on the quality of the body-shape detection hardware, sensor calibration and the library of programs. Datasheets alone are insufficient; a physical trial or documented test protocol is advisable before large-volume commitments.
  • A 14-model series can carry different feature sets at different price points. Buyers should verify AI health detection and other intelligent features on the specific model under evaluation rather than assuming they are uniform across the series.

Future Outlook

In the next phase of the massage chair market, AI health detection will likely shift from a single feature to an integrated wellness platform. The direction of travel is toward chairs that suggest the right program from minimal input — body shape, usage history and user preference — rather than requiring users to navigate 24 programs manually.

For importers and distributors, this has concrete consequences. Product documentation will need to distinguish between hardware capabilities, software features and certified safety compliance. Buyers will ask suppliers to explain how the AI layer works, what data it collects and whether the algorithm can be updated. Data privacy will become an evaluation criterion, particularly for EU distribution where CE-marked electrical products operate inside a stricter regulatory environment.
